093737805333ae849527bbc5da92f4beae6d9a1f.svn-base 11 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360361362363364365366367368369370
  1. package org.jeecg.modules.online.cgreport.entity;
  2. import com.baomidou.mybatisplus.annotation.IdType;
  3. import com.baomidou.mybatisplus.annotation.TableId;
  4. import com.baomidou.mybatisplus.annotation.TableName;
  5. import com.fasterxml.jackson.annotation.JsonFormat;
  6. import java.io.Serializable;
  7. import java.util.Date;
  8. import org.jeecg.common.aspect.annotation.Dict;
  9. import org.springframework.format.annotation.DateTimeFormat;
  10. @TableName("onl_cgreport_head")
  11. public class OnlCgreportHead implements Serializable {
  12. private static final long serialVersionUID = 1L;
  13. @TableId(
  14. type = IdType.ASSIGN_ID
  15. )
  16. private String id;
  17. private String code;
  18. private String name;
  19. private String cgrSql;
  20. private String returnValField;
  21. private String returnTxtField;
  22. private String returnType;
  23. @Dict(
  24. dicCode = "code",
  25. dicText = "name",
  26. dictTable = "sys_data_source"
  27. )
  28. private String dbSource;
  29. private String content;
  30. @JsonFormat(
  31. timezone = "GMT+8",
  32. pattern = "yyyy-MM-dd HH:mm:ss"
  33. )
  34. @DateTimeFormat(
  35. pattern = "yyyy-MM-dd HH:mm:ss"
  36. )
  37. private Date updateTime;
  38. private String updateBy;
  39. @JsonFormat(
  40. timezone = "GMT+8",
  41. pattern = "yyyy-MM-dd HH:mm:ss"
  42. )
  43. @DateTimeFormat(
  44. pattern = "yyyy-MM-dd HH:mm:ss"
  45. )
  46. private Date createTime;
  47. private String createBy;
  48. public OnlCgreportHead() {
  49. }
  50. public String getId() {
  51. return this.id;
  52. }
  53. public String getCode() {
  54. return this.code;
  55. }
  56. public String getName() {
  57. return this.name;
  58. }
  59. public String getCgrSql() {
  60. return this.cgrSql;
  61. }
  62. public String getReturnValField() {
  63. return this.returnValField;
  64. }
  65. public String getReturnTxtField() {
  66. return this.returnTxtField;
  67. }
  68. public String getReturnType() {
  69. return this.returnType;
  70. }
  71. public String getDbSource() {
  72. return this.dbSource;
  73. }
  74. public String getContent() {
  75. return this.content;
  76. }
  77. public Date getUpdateTime() {
  78. return this.updateTime;
  79. }
  80. public String getUpdateBy() {
  81. return this.updateBy;
  82. }
  83. public Date getCreateTime() {
  84. return this.createTime;
  85. }
  86. public String getCreateBy() {
  87. return this.createBy;
  88. }
  89. public void setId(String id) {
  90. this.id = id;
  91. }
  92. public void setCode(String code) {
  93. this.code = code;
  94. }
  95. public void setName(String name) {
  96. this.name = name;
  97. }
  98. public void setCgrSql(String cgrSql) {
  99. this.cgrSql = cgrSql;
  100. }
  101. public void setReturnValField(String returnValField) {
  102. this.returnValField = returnValField;
  103. }
  104. public void setReturnTxtField(String returnTxtField) {
  105. this.returnTxtField = returnTxtField;
  106. }
  107. public void setReturnType(String returnType) {
  108. this.returnType = returnType;
  109. }
  110. public void setDbSource(String dbSource) {
  111. this.dbSource = dbSource;
  112. }
  113. public void setContent(String content) {
  114. this.content = content;
  115. }
  116. public void setUpdateTime(Date updateTime) {
  117. this.updateTime = updateTime;
  118. }
  119. public void setUpdateBy(String updateBy) {
  120. this.updateBy = updateBy;
  121. }
  122. public void setCreateTime(Date createTime) {
  123. this.createTime = createTime;
  124. }
  125. public void setCreateBy(String createBy) {
  126. this.createBy = createBy;
  127. }
  128. public boolean equals(Object o) {
  129. if (o == this) {
  130. return true;
  131. } else if (!(o instanceof OnlCgreportHead)) {
  132. return false;
  133. } else {
  134. OnlCgreportHead var2 = (OnlCgreportHead)o;
  135. if (!var2.canEqual(this)) {
  136. return false;
  137. } else {
  138. label167: {
  139. String var3 = this.getId();
  140. String var4 = var2.getId();
  141. if (var3 == null) {
  142. if (var4 == null) {
  143. break label167;
  144. }
  145. } else if (var3.equals(var4)) {
  146. break label167;
  147. }
  148. return false;
  149. }
  150. String var5 = this.getCode();
  151. String var6 = var2.getCode();
  152. if (var5 == null) {
  153. if (var6 != null) {
  154. return false;
  155. }
  156. } else if (!var5.equals(var6)) {
  157. return false;
  158. }
  159. label153: {
  160. String var7 = this.getName();
  161. String var8 = var2.getName();
  162. if (var7 == null) {
  163. if (var8 == null) {
  164. break label153;
  165. }
  166. } else if (var7.equals(var8)) {
  167. break label153;
  168. }
  169. return false;
  170. }
  171. String var9 = this.getCgrSql();
  172. String var10 = var2.getCgrSql();
  173. if (var9 == null) {
  174. if (var10 != null) {
  175. return false;
  176. }
  177. } else if (!var9.equals(var10)) {
  178. return false;
  179. }
  180. label139: {
  181. String var11 = this.getReturnValField();
  182. String var12 = var2.getReturnValField();
  183. if (var11 == null) {
  184. if (var12 == null) {
  185. break label139;
  186. }
  187. } else if (var11.equals(var12)) {
  188. break label139;
  189. }
  190. return false;
  191. }
  192. String var13 = this.getReturnTxtField();
  193. String var14 = var2.getReturnTxtField();
  194. if (var13 == null) {
  195. if (var14 != null) {
  196. return false;
  197. }
  198. } else if (!var13.equals(var14)) {
  199. return false;
  200. }
  201. label125: {
  202. String var15 = this.getReturnType();
  203. String var16 = var2.getReturnType();
  204. if (var15 == null) {
  205. if (var16 == null) {
  206. break label125;
  207. }
  208. } else if (var15.equals(var16)) {
  209. break label125;
  210. }
  211. return false;
  212. }
  213. label118: {
  214. String var17 = this.getDbSource();
  215. String var18 = var2.getDbSource();
  216. if (var17 == null) {
  217. if (var18 == null) {
  218. break label118;
  219. }
  220. } else if (var17.equals(var18)) {
  221. break label118;
  222. }
  223. return false;
  224. }
  225. String var19 = this.getContent();
  226. String var20 = var2.getContent();
  227. if (var19 == null) {
  228. if (var20 != null) {
  229. return false;
  230. }
  231. } else if (!var19.equals(var20)) {
  232. return false;
  233. }
  234. label104: {
  235. Date var21 = this.getUpdateTime();
  236. Date var22 = var2.getUpdateTime();
  237. if (var21 == null) {
  238. if (var22 == null) {
  239. break label104;
  240. }
  241. } else if (var21.equals(var22)) {
  242. break label104;
  243. }
  244. return false;
  245. }
  246. label97: {
  247. String var23 = this.getUpdateBy();
  248. String var24 = var2.getUpdateBy();
  249. if (var23 == null) {
  250. if (var24 == null) {
  251. break label97;
  252. }
  253. } else if (var23.equals(var24)) {
  254. break label97;
  255. }
  256. return false;
  257. }
  258. Date var25 = this.getCreateTime();
  259. Date var26 = var2.getCreateTime();
  260. if (var25 == null) {
  261. if (var26 != null) {
  262. return false;
  263. }
  264. } else if (!var25.equals(var26)) {
  265. return false;
  266. }
  267. String var27 = this.getCreateBy();
  268. String var28 = var2.getCreateBy();
  269. if (var27 == null) {
  270. if (var28 != null) {
  271. return false;
  272. }
  273. } else if (!var27.equals(var28)) {
  274. return false;
  275. }
  276. return true;
  277. }
  278. }
  279. }
  280. protected boolean canEqual(Object other) {
  281. return other instanceof OnlCgreportHead;
  282. }
  283. public int hashCode() {
  284. boolean var1 = true;
  285. byte var2 = 1;
  286. String var3 = this.getId();
  287. int var16 = var2 * 59 + (var3 == null ? 43 : var3.hashCode());
  288. String var4 = this.getCode();
  289. var16 = var16 * 59 + (var4 == null ? 43 : var4.hashCode());
  290. String var5 = this.getName();
  291. var16 = var16 * 59 + (var5 == null ? 43 : var5.hashCode());
  292. String var6 = this.getCgrSql();
  293. var16 = var16 * 59 + (var6 == null ? 43 : var6.hashCode());
  294. String var7 = this.getReturnValField();
  295. var16 = var16 * 59 + (var7 == null ? 43 : var7.hashCode());
  296. String var8 = this.getReturnTxtField();
  297. var16 = var16 * 59 + (var8 == null ? 43 : var8.hashCode());
  298. String var9 = this.getReturnType();
  299. var16 = var16 * 59 + (var9 == null ? 43 : var9.hashCode());
  300. String var10 = this.getDbSource();
  301. var16 = var16 * 59 + (var10 == null ? 43 : var10.hashCode());
  302. String var11 = this.getContent();
  303. var16 = var16 * 59 + (var11 == null ? 43 : var11.hashCode());
  304. Date var12 = this.getUpdateTime();
  305. var16 = var16 * 59 + (var12 == null ? 43 : var12.hashCode());
  306. String var13 = this.getUpdateBy();
  307. var16 = var16 * 59 + (var13 == null ? 43 : var13.hashCode());
  308. Date var14 = this.getCreateTime();
  309. var16 = var16 * 59 + (var14 == null ? 43 : var14.hashCode());
  310. String var15 = this.getCreateBy();
  311. var16 = var16 * 59 + (var15 == null ? 43 : var15.hashCode());
  312. return var16;
  313. }
  314. public String toString() {
  315. return "OnlCgreportHead(id=" + this.getId() + ", code=" + this.getCode() + ", name=" + this.getName() + ", cgrSql=" + this.getCgrSql() + ", returnValField=" + this.getReturnValField() + ", returnTxtField=" + this.getReturnTxtField() + ", returnType=" + this.getReturnType() + ", dbSource=" + this.getDbSource() + ", content=" + this.getContent() + ", updateTime=" + this.getUpdateTime() + ", updateBy=" + this.getUpdateBy() + ", createTime=" + this.getCreateTime() + ", createBy=" + this.getCreateBy() + ")";
  316. }
  317. }